Phillip Coleman - AT&T

Phillip Coleman is an AVP of Product Management and Development at AT&T. His responsibility includes 5G, Private Cellular Networks, and mobility network services for businesses. Prior to this, he held other AT&T Business leadership roles, including management of the 5G standalone product development program. He also directed teams that helped grow IoT Connectivity, IoT Solutions, and edge computing revenue.

Phillip brings 21 years of experience in cellular network operations, analytics, and sales. He started his career at AT&T Wireless as a Network Design Engineer building and optimizing 2G and 3G networks in the Dallas area before working at Capital One as a Business Manager guiding a team growing a direct-to-consumer auto finance business. He then returned to AT&T to manage a cross-functional team responsible for the sale and contracting of indoor cellular solutions for Enterprise clients. He holds an undergraduate degree in Electrical Engineering from Texas A&M and an MBA from Southern Methodist University.
